
Pegasus Bay is located in the Waipara district of Canterbury, about thirty minutes north of Christchurch. As you approach the winery from the south, you will be struck by its distinct architecture and carefully planted gardens. Pegasus Bay's wines are made by Lynette Hudson and Mathew Donaldson. Their annual release is eagerly awaited and their Rieslings are regarded by many as amongst the very best produced in New Zealand. Pegasus Bay is also well regarded for its Pinot Noir and Chardonnay. The Riesling grape however, is particularly well suited to Canterbury. It's a grape that likes to ripen slowly and if left to late autumn develops intense flavours. The Pegasus Bay Riesling is characterised by intense citrus and honey flavours, and rewards cellaring for at least three years. Second tier wines are marketed under the "Main Divide" label.
